Product Description Poetry. In the new collection of poetry BAD WITH FACES, poet Sean Norton delights in finding significance in the most unexpected of places, from a poetry reading interrupted by noisy caterers to the accidental connections between titles on a bookshelf. Bold and inventive, BAD WITH FACES challenges the reader to search everyday experiences for the hints toward enlightenment lying just below the surface. Jason Bredle, Endorsement, March 1, 2005 About the Author Sean Norton received his MFA in Poetry from the University of Michigan and his BA from the University of Oregon after a couple of false starts at other schools. In the past he has taught poetry, fiction, and essay writing at the University of Michigan. Currently he works as an events planner.
